
Did you know that Meals on Wheels London offers more than just meal delivery? Many people we meet at fairs and events are surprised to learn about our Wheels for Wellness program, which is a dedicated transportation service that helps seniors and individuals with disabilities get to important wellness-related appointments. Whether it’s a trip to the doctor, or a physiotherapy session, a fitness class, or even a haircut, Wheels for Wellness provides safe and affordable, round-trip rides that help our clients stay healthy, independent, and connected to their community.Â
For many of London’s seniors and neighbours living with disabilities, getting to essential appointments isn’t as simple as hopping in the car. Public transportation can be overwhelming and not always reliable, especially for those with mobility challenges. In fact, the London Transit Commision’s Voice of the Customer survey reported low to average satisfaction in key areas like on-time performance and frequency of service, both of which were identified as high-priority areas for improvement. This reinforces what many of our clients already experience firsthand: getting to a medical or wellness appointment isn’t always easy. Access to safe, reliable, and affordable transportation empowers people to attend appointments and community programs that support their health, independence, and quality of life. It’s about maintaining dignity and staying connected to the community. Â

The cost of a round-trip ride with Wheels for Wellness is $24 and subsidy may be available based on income to help reduce the cost in which rides could be as low as $17.
To help us coordinate schedules, we suggest booking a ride a week in advance, but please reach out if you have an appointment sooner than that. We are able to accommodate appointments up to 3 hours, with flexibility for longer depending on the situation.
